Things to do in Bernardsville?
Bernardsville, NJ is a small suburban town located in Somerset County in New Jersey. It has a population of slightly over 7,500 people and offers a peaceful atmosphere with plenty of green space to explore. The downtown area is filled with quaint shops and restaurants, while the surrounding neighborhoods feature beautiful homes on tree-lined streets. Residents can enjoy the nearby parks, trails and recreational facilities while being close enough to both NYC and Philadelphia to take advantage of all that those cities have to offer. Overall, Bernardsville provides residents with a safe and pleasant place to live that allows them to take advantage of both small town charm as well as larger city amenities.
